Ariana Grande Performs With Nicki Minaj At Halftime Show

Singers Ariana Grande and Nicki Minaj stole the show at the 64th NBA All-Star Game.
 
Grande was selected to perform at this year's halftime show of the basketball game inside Madison Square Garden Feb 15, reports eonline.com. 
 
Wearing a cheerleader-like outfit complete with her signature ponytail hairstyle, rapper Big Sean's girlfriend sang a number of her smash hits including “The way”, “Break free” and “Love me harder”.
 
As an added treat, the 21-year-old also introduced special guest Minaj to the stage midway through her performance. 
 
The duo crooned their hit collaboration titled “Bang bang”. 
 
“Thank u babes!! that was too fun thanks again NBA & thank u @NICKIMINAJ. i love uu!!” Grande tweeted after the show.
